Netflix to clamp down on VPN prospects

Netflix has promised to make points troublesome for viewers that use proxy servers to entry content material materials from totally different worldwide areas. In a blog post titled “Evolving Proxy Detection as a Worldwide Service”, vp of content material materials provide construction David Fullagar claimed that the next few weeks would see the rollout of latest measures specializing in VPNs.

“In coming weeks, these using proxies and unblockers will solely have the power to entry the service throughout the nation the place they at current are,” wrote Fullagar. “We’re assured this variation gained’t have an effect on members not using proxies.”

The company doesn’t give any knowledge on the way in which it intends to dam VPNs, although this would possibly merely be a matter of blocking IP addresses tied to proxy servers. Elsewhere throughout the submit, Fullagar acknowledged that proxy servers wouldn’t be important if the content material materials was accessible globally:

“Over time, we anticipate being able to take motion,” he wrote. “For now, given the historic observe of licensing content material materials by geographic territories, the TV reveals and flicks we offer differ, to varied ranges, by territory. Throughout the meantime, we’re going to proceed to respect and implement content material materials licensing by geographic location.”

At CES 2016, Netflix CEO Reed Hastings launched an development of its streaming service to 130 further worldwide areas, along with Russia and India.
